合理利用css的权重:提高代码的重用性

来源:互联网 发布:vb 数组 编辑:程序博客网 时间:2024/04/29 20:29

一、关于css样式中的6种基础的选择器

  • 1、ID选择器
  • 2、CLASS选择器
  • 3、属性选择器(如a[href="xxx"])
  • 4、伪类和伪对象选择器(如::hover ::after)
  • 5、标签选择器(如:a,span)
  • 6、通配选择器(如:*)

二、关于css样式的三种组合

  • 1、后代选择器(如:.reader .title{})
  • 2、子选择器(如:.reader > .title{})
  • 3、相邻选择器(如:.reader + .title{})

三、关于各选择器的权重值

  • 1、ID选择器权重 = 100
  • 2、CLASS选择器权重 = 10
  • 3、属性选择器权重= 10
  • 4、伪类选择器权重 = 10
  • 5、标签选择器权重 = 1
  • 6、伪对象选择器权重 = 1
  • 7、通配选择器权重 = 0
原创粉丝点击